Transaction 51dc3377e776e76b50de462b6c2613d8cef13461b33f7af3f07d3fd4a1e10a1f
1 Input
2 Outputs
- 51dc3377e776e76b50de462b6c2613d8cef13461b33f7af3f07d3fd4a1e10a1f:0
- 51dc3377e776e76b50de462b6c2613d8cef13461b33f7af3f07d3fd4a1e10a1f:1
value 67584229
address 1LGjwYgy2NX4E3gUgYUwNcc41VKxhTGjXe
value 27869050181
address 1H2azAxLbRWEtjpXjiUG32McV9ZD4xf7o6